why are the factors in your multiplication sentences in a different order​

In multiplication, the order doesn't matter.

2 rows of 7 and 7 rows of 2 is the same.

If you have seven 2's, that's the same as two 7's.

See here:

2 + 2 + 2 + 2 + 2 + 2 + 2 = 14

7 + 7 = 14

Or:

2 * 7 = 7 * 2 = 14
